Output 61a07917c187bca44ca24888f138f317c2c0d6bc07793bf55ea3ec205e8de3ce:4

value
1044574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9f62fda067c8c67b13e3781c127cdc860186215 OP_EQUAL
address
3MZVUYAKyqCDtDWNYgwfRcGmuZ3eutjiEQ
transaction
61a07917c187bca44ca24888f138f317c2c0d6bc07793bf55ea3ec205e8de3ce
spent
true